Bedford is a charming city located in Cuyahoga County, Ohio. With a population of around 13,000 residents, Bedford offers a small-town atmosphere with all the amenities of a larger city. The city is known for its rich history, vibrant community, and beautiful natural surroundings.
One of the most striking features of Bedford is its historic downtown area. The city is home to many well-preserved 19th-century buildings, including the Old Bank Building and the Fuller House. These architectural gems serve as a reminder of Bedford’s past and add character to the city’s landscape. In addition to its historic buildings, downtown Bedford is also home to a variety of shops, restaurants, and businesses, making it a popular destination for locals and visitors alike.
For those who enjoy spending time outdoors, Bedford has several parks and recreational facilities to explore. The city’s parks offer a range of amenities, including playgrounds, picnic areas, and walking trails. Bedford Reservation, part of the Cleveland Metroparks system, is a popular spot for nature enthusiasts. The reservation features scenic overlooks, hiking trails, and opportunities for birdwatching, making it a great place to connect with the natural beauty of the area.
Bedford also boasts a strong sense of community and hosts a variety of events and festivals throughout the year. The city’s annual Labor Day Festival is a highlight for many residents, featuring live music, food vendors, and a parade. The festival brings the community together and provides a fun and festive atmosphere for all who attend.
In addition to its rich history and natural beauty, Bedford is also conveniently located near major highways, allowing for easy access to nearby cities such as Cleveland and Akron. This makes it an attractive option for those who want to enjoy the benefits of small-town living while still being within reach of urban amenities.
